首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ThreeJS和VR (WebXR)调试

ThreeJS是一个基于JavaScript的开源3D图形库,用于创建和显示3D图形场景。它提供了丰富的功能和工具,使开发人员能够轻松地在Web浏览器中创建交互式的3D应用程序和游戏。

VR (WebXR)调试是指在虚拟现实(VR)和增强现实(AR)应用程序开发过程中,使用调试工具来检查和修复代码中的错误和问题。VR调试可以帮助开发人员确保应用程序在VR设备上正常运行,并提供最佳的用户体验。

在进行ThreeJS和VR (WebXR)调试时,可以采取以下步骤:

  1. 确保正确设置ThreeJS环境:在使用ThreeJS之前,需要引入ThreeJS库文件,并创建一个场景、相机和渲染器。可以使用ThreeJS的文档和示例代码来学习如何正确设置环境。
  2. 使用浏览器的开发者工具:现代浏览器通常都提供了强大的开发者工具,可以用于调试JavaScript代码。可以使用浏览器的控制台来查看错误消息、警告和日志输出,以帮助定位和解决问题。
  3. 使用ThreeJS的调试工具:ThreeJS提供了一些内置的调试工具,可以帮助开发人员检查场景中的对象、材质、光源等属性,并进行相应的调整。例如,可以使用ThreeJS的GUI库来创建一个可视化的调试界面,用于动态修改场景中的参数。
  4. 使用VR设备的调试工具:如果正在进行VR应用程序的开发,可以使用VR设备的调试工具来检查和修复与VR相关的问题。不同的VR设备可能提供不同的调试工具,例如Oculus提供了Oculus Debug Tool,可以用于调整VR应用程序的性能和渲染设置。
  5. 参考ThreeJS和WebXR的文档和社区:ThreeJS和WebXR都有详细的文档和活跃的社区,可以在其中寻找答案和解决方案。可以查阅官方文档、浏览论坛和社区,以获取关于ThreeJS和WebXR调试的最新信息和技巧。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种计算需求。链接地址:https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L版:提供高性能、可扩展的云数据库服务,适用于存储和管理大规模数据。链接地址: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云对象存储(COS):提供安全、可靠的云存储服务,适用于存储和管理各种类型的数据。链接地址:https://cloud.tencent.com/product/cos

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Threejs入门之十八:GUI调试器的使用

GUI是图形用户界面(Graphical User Interface)的简写,为了方便我们在编写代码时对相机、灯光等对象的参数进行实时调节,Threejs为我们提供了GUI库,使用它,可以快速创建控制三维场景的...UI交互界面;threejs三维空间的很多参数都需要通过GUI的方式调试出来。...console.log(val); spotLightHelper.update()})添加上述代码后,在刷新浏览器,控制滑块发现聚光灯的散射角度变化时,聚光灯辅助类也会跟着变化 我们可以将上面的add方法onChange...close()// 坐标子菜单关闭const positionFolder = sportLightFolder.addFolder('坐标').close()看效果 这里只是以聚光灯为例来说明GUI调试器的使用...,它可以监视任何控制对象,比如相机,比如物体等,更多使用方法,还需要我们不断摸索实践。

86421

Threejs进阶之十七:Threejs中的Path、ShapeShapeGeometry类

在实际的应用中,有时候需要我们根据一个二维图形拉伸为三维图形的情况,这就需要我们对Threejs中提供的二维图形相关的类有一个深入的了解,这一节我们就深入的聊一聊Threejs中的Path、Shape...示例代码: path.moveTo( 10, 10 ); .lineTo( x, y ):在路径中创建一个新的点(x,y),并在该点上一个点之间画一条直线。无返回值。...cx2,cy2),并与当前点结束点形成三次贝塞尔曲线。...在形状以及.holes(孔洞)数组上调用getPoints,并返回一个来自于: { shape holes } 的对象,其中的形状孔洞是Vector2数组。...在Threejs开发指南中找到一个比较详细介绍上述方法的图表,参考如下 示例代码 function initShapeMesh() { // 创建一个形状 const shape = new

1K20

这是一个基于Threejs的商品VR展示系统的 VR模型展示Demo

vr-cake-demo 这是一个基于Threejs的商品VR展示系统的 VR模型展示Demo Demo界面示意图 Demo蛋糕实物图片 Demo蛋糕VR效果图 研究意义 2020年,已经进入了5G...考虑当前市场形式,利用虚拟现实技术理论,结合计算机网络、交互设计实现一个以普通电脑或手机浏览器为载体的适用于用户或消费者需求的VR展示平台系统,打造一种全新的商品展示方式,使得用户或者消费者的购物体验得到大大优化提高...项目成果 在VR商品展示中能够任意的改变观察的角度,视点的距离,将商品模型进行分解展示,更好地了解认识想要了解的商品信息特征,并且可以对商品模型进行一定的修改,满足不同顾客的不同个性化需求。...主要分为商品展示、模型交互展示模型自定义。...更多相关信息 可通过这篇文章进一步了解 基于threejs的商品VR展示平台的设计与实现思路 相关运用 实际运用视频展示 three.js VR模型制作演示 About 一个VR蛋糕模型展示 fivecc.gitee.io

62610

基于threejs的商品VR展示平台的设计与实现思路

目录 基于threejs的商品VR展示平台的设计与实现思路 前言 总体开发方案设计 总体开发设计思维导图 模型制作模块 前端展示模块 存储模块 后端管理模块 后台管理实现 商品模型制作 商品模型前期准备...商品模型展示环境搭建 商品模型组件制作 模型在线编辑功能实现 模型轮廓高亮实现 模型分解运动的实现 基于threejs的商品VR展示平台的设计与实现思路 前言 本设计针对目前互联网销售传统展示的现状,...在浏览器Threejs以及云数据库做储存的支持下处理产生三维立体的虚拟空间环境,使得浏览者有了身临其境的“沉浸感”人机交互的能力。...vr模型制作演示 总体开发方案设计 根据当前互联网销售行业的现状的展示方面的不足和局限,从新生一代的消费群体的消费观念以及需求进行了设计,设计出一种全新的设计思路,其扩展性、适用性交互性得到了充分的体现...前端展示模块 前端展示模块,主要面向顾客,给顾客展示商品的信息,商家动态,商品购买的方式等,在VR商品展示中能够任意的改变观察的角度,视点的距离,将商品模型进行分解展示,更好地了解认识想要了解的商品信息特征

68040

谷歌IO大会进行时:ARVR、AI愈发高冷?谷歌决定把他们low下来

推出Chrome WebXR标准,可将XR内容带至网页端 今年年初,Mozilla推出了名为WebXR的新标准,可将XR(AR、VRMR)内容直接集成至网络浏览器。...在今天的I/O大会上,主题为“The Future of the Web Is Immersive”的演讲者Brandon JonesJohn Pallett给大家演示了WebXR的一些新功能。...而WebXR正是为了解决所述问题而诞生的新标准,同时将把ARMR内容带至网页端。 Brandon Jones表示,WebXR针对浏览器进行了更多的优化,将为程序员的开发带来便利。...但在WebXR标准下,可达到1603×2529分辨率,400万像素,同时还能维持相同的高帧率。这意味着这项新技术可以使AR/VR内容在网页运行时,画面将更优秀、更流畅。...针对这些问题,谷歌在I/O大会上联合Labster推出了VR实验室。 据悉,谷歌Labster通过高级模拟以及Daydream平台来构建数学精确方程,以此反映真实世界的结果。

682120

PHP核心作者转战VR,作为前端的你还没了解过WebXR就out了!

今天,鸟哥(惠新宸)发了自己的最新博文,称自己正在专注贝壳的一个VR看房项目。鸟哥何许人也?...VR看房这个功能,也契合了可遇见将来,所谓web3.0时代的潮流趋势。作为前端开发者,实际上在我们前端领域,已经有WebXR这个标准在发展了。...它WebRTC一样,也是基于设备接口的一类标准,也就是说,基于WebXR的应用,是需要依赖一些设备接口的,可以预料,这里的设备可能就是类似VR眼镜、触感铠甲之类的设备,当然,除了视觉,听觉、触觉对应的设备可能也会被考虑其中...整套标准设计了一组 WebXR Device API ( https://www.w3.org/TR/webxr/ ),它主要包含: 查找兼容的VR或AR输出设备 以适当的帧率将3D场景渲染到设备 (可选...基于WebXR的应用,可以在浏览器等设备上运行,这也就意味着,只要在马路边立一块显示屏,内置一个浏览器,就可以运行XR应用,随时路过的路人进行实时的虚拟现实互动,从而达到非常酷炫的沉浸式体验,让产品营销更上一个台阶

58650

Android版Chrome 67发布,为ARVR带来全新API接口

对于Android用户来说,这是一个好消息,Chrome 67已经开始推出一系列新功能API,允许开发者使用虚拟现实(VR)增强现实(AR)体验。...Android版新版Chrome自带一个新的WebXR设备API,旨在实现基于Web的ARVR体验。新API仍在测试中,但在其发布版本中,开发人员将能够开始使用它,并看到它为移动平台带来的好处。...旨在专门支持移动设备台式机的API旨在统一支持AR的设备,基于移动的VR耳机(如Google Daydream View)桌面托管的耳机(包括Oculus Rift,HTC ViveWindows...除了新的WebXR设备API之外,Chrome 67还为其带来了通用传感器API,使开发人员能够轻松获取传感器数据,从而为我们创建身临其境的游戏,健身追踪AR或VR体验的Web应用程序。...WebXR设备API通用传感器API都在今年4月份公布,现在可以在Chrome 67中使用。 开发人员需要注册原始试用程序员才能开始使用WebXR设备API,但其开始的好处肯定值得在早期实施。

50320

Google IO 2018丨ARVR、AI“高冷”?谷歌正把它们变得更加亲民

推出Chrome WebXR标准,可将XR内容带至网页端 今年年初,Mozilla推出了名为WebXR的新标准,可将XR(AR、VRMR)内容直接集成至网络浏览器。...在今天的I/O大会上,主题为“The Future of the Web Is Immersive”的演讲者Brandon JonesJohn Pallett给大家演示了WebXR的一些新功能。...而WebXR正是为了解决所述问题而诞生的新标准,同时将把ARMR内容带至网页端。 ? Brandon Jones表示,WebXR针对浏览器进行了更多的优化,将为程序员的开发带来便利。...但在WebXR标准下,可达到1603×2529分辨率,400万像素,同时还能维持相同的高帧率。这意味着这项新技术可以使AR/VR内容在网页运行时,画面将更优秀、更流畅。...针对这些问题,谷歌在I/O大会上联合Labster推出了VR实验室。 ? 据悉,谷歌Labster通过高级模拟以及Daydream平台来构建数学精确方程,以此反映真实世界的结果。

50060

4.19 VR扫描:Valve最新VR控制器发布新的固件更新;新版Edge将支持WMR头显

而此次更新则是增加了逻辑运算,根据手指随时间的活动进行检测,以适应不同大小的手掌手指的放置。 VRPinea独家点评:通过增加的运算逻辑,该控制器对手指的跟踪应该精准了!...并且,开发者版本Canary版本现已支持WMR头显,用户可以通过相关的头显直接浏览WebVR/WebXR内容。...而要使用这一功能,只需在地址栏输入edge://flags,并启用WebVR或WebXR flag即可。...该游戏将支持VR移动设备。在该游戏中,VR玩家将扮演一棵巨树,保护黄金橡果。而移动设备玩家则将控制一群企图偷走黄金橡果的捣蛋松鼠。巨树可以使用不同的能力来减缓松鼠的速度,比如投掷石块。...据官方介绍,该应用通过VR技术能再现历史遗迹,同时使用声音、触觉其他观感,增强观众的体验。而更多的细节体验将在未来几个月公布。 VRPinea独家点评:用VR讲述的历史应该比电影电视剧震撼的多!

72240

8.23 VR扫描:Oculus计划在2019年Q1发售VR一体机Santa Cruz

Mozilla WebXR应用Hubs开始支持文档、视频、3D模型导入 ? 近日,火狐浏览器开发厂商Mozilla宣布,将为其联机WebXR应用程序Hubs带来一次大更新。...近日,日本VR游戏开发商MyDearest洛杉矶游戏发行商Sekai Preject宣布,他们联合打造的VR冒险解谜游戏《Tokyo Chronos》众筹成功,众筹金额为90625美元。...近日,索尼宣布将推出一个名为“PlayStation VR Exciting Pack”的特殊捆绑包,该捆绑包包含头显、PlayStation摄像头两个PS Move手柄,售价36980日元(约合2300...《鲨卷风》电影将推VR游戏,支持PC端移动端 ? 近日,《鲨卷风6:最后的鲨卷风》正在美国上映。与此同时,该系列VR游戏《鲨卷风:风暴之眼VR》也正式对外公布。...据悉,该游戏支持PC端移动端,预计将于今年下半年上线。 VRPinea独家点评:现象级雷片《鲨卷风》推出VR游戏了,好怕怕!

46020

7.19 VR扫描:Valve发布游戏掌机Steam Deck;《Moss》销量突破100万份

04 VR绘画《Brushwork VR》 支持WebXR浏览器在线创作 《Brushwork VR》应用基于浏览器的沉浸式绘画体验,可让用户在VR中制作精美的艺术作品,并且无需额外下载应用。...该方法支持用户使用兼容WebXR浏览器的VR头显,在虚拟环境中进行VR绘画。...《Brushwork VR》提供了多种尺寸的画布画笔选择,当画笔沿着画布拖动时,绘画效果非常逼真,并且《Brushwork VR》支持用户从任何角度拿起画笔进行绘画。...VRPinea独家点评:基于WebXR浏览器的VR绘画应用正显露出很大的市场潜力。...《Arcadia》将老式街机游戏现代VR技术与传统运动相结合,提供激烈的竞技体验。

59330

7.26 VR扫描:苹果收购Intel部分手机调制解调器业务;Unity完成5.25亿美元融资

据悉,该笔资金将用于人员扩招,并面向更多地区,提供个人VR医疗VR护理服务。 VRPinea独家点评:VR医疗近期的科技成果不少,相关行业融资是要开始了吗?...3Glasses X1 VR眼镜通过美国FCC、欧盟CE认证 ? 日前,3Glasses推出了新一代消费级超薄VR眼镜3Glasses X1。...而近日,该眼镜已通过美国FCC欧盟CE认证,将登陆欧美市场。3Glasses X1 VR眼镜非常轻便,裸机重量小于150克,机身尺寸为165×61.8×23.5mm。...WebXR浏览器Firefox Reality登陆Oculus Quest ? 近日,Mozilla的WebXR浏览器Firefox Reality已正式登陆Oculus Quest。...此外,为保护用户免受广告网络技术公司对个人数据的跟踪收集,Firefox Reality默认启用了增强跟踪保护功能。 VRPinea独家点评:该浏览器支持十种不同的语言,同时还支持语音搜索。

47620
领券